IELTS Speaking test in Canada – September 2016

Our friend H took the IELTS Speaking test in Canada and remembered the following questions:

Speaking testIELTS test in Canada

Interview

– What is your full name?
– Can I see your ID?
– Where are you from?
– Do you work or study?
– Why did you choose this field?
– Do you like celebrities? Why?
– Would you like to be a celebrity? Why?
– Who are the favourite celebrities in your country?
– Have you ever met a celebrity in person?
– What colour do you like the most? Why?
– What colours are preferred by your friends? Why?

Cue Card

Describe a moment or an instance you experienced that made you laugh a lot. Please say

– When and where was it?
– Describe the situation.
– Who was there with you?

Discussion

– What is the difference between comedy on TV and comedy books?
– Are there comedy shows in your country?
– Can someone use humour to learn another language?
– Can humour be translated from one language to another?
– Are there jokes in your language that sound differently in another language?
– Why do you think it is so?

IELTS test in India – September 2016 (General Training)

When P took the IELTS test in India, the following questions were asked:

Listening testIELTS test in India

Section 1. Description of a cinemas complex, including movie session times, cinema capacity and additional facilities.
Questions: filling in blanks.

Section 2. A diagram description of a two-level building.
Questions: diagram/map labeling.

Section 3. A lecture and discussion about music.
Questions: multiple choice.

Section 4. A talk about research on caves and flying bats.
Questions: multiple choice.

Reading test

Passage 1. About three different sport clubs and their facilities.
Questions: match clubs to their facilities.

Passage 2. How to write a job offer letter and application.
Questions: filling in blanks.

Passage 3, 4. Don’t remember.

Writing test

Writing task 1 (a letter)

You have a ticket to a music concert. Write a letter to your friend offering it to him/her, because you won’t be able to attend the concert. Include the following in your letter

– Why won’t you be able to attend?
– Give details about the concert.
– How will you provide the ticket to him/her?

Writing Task 2 (an essay)

Nowadays there is a rapid increase of rubbish amounts all around the world. What are the main causes for it? What can be a solution, in your opinion?
